We enjoyed our stay and especially the proximity of Longwood Gardens. Everything about the hotel was pleasant - room clean and spacious with lots of plugs. The bed was comfortable and room was quiet. The breakfast was tasty and there was an ample selection; just don't expect your Hilton credit to cover the full cost. The only caution is for guests with mobility issues. The accessible rooms are at the far end of the hall. The room doors are quite heavy and I'm not sure a person traveling alone in a wheelchair would be able to manage them. Also, although the tub/shower combo had good grab bars, the tub floor was like glass and extremely slippery and there was no rubber mat. I'd definitely stay here again if in the area.

Overall it was a great stay. The room was quiet, comfortable and clean. In fact, the entire hotel was spotless.
Upon checkin though it was clear the hotel is dealing with some staffing challenges. I arrived around 7 pm and there was no one in the lobby, no checkin agent, no bartender at the restaurant, just a sign saying they had stepped away. After about 10 minutes I knocked on the door to the office, no response, about 5 minutes later someone finally emerged from the office to check me in.
The next morning I asked for a 2 pm checkout so I could complete a work call and the hotel happily gave it to me which was very much appreciated.
Everyone I encountered was friendly and I would definitely stay again next time I’m in the area.

What a disappointment! Our first stay at a HGI was nice, refined, and comfortable, but our experience this week was like at a budget motel. The room had a nice mattress but no blanket on the bed or in the room--just a lumpy comforter in a polyester cover. Road noise awoke me at 5 a.m. and did not let up (rooms need insulated windows). There were dark hairs on the shower floor. The Zero bath products smelled nice. No shower cap available even at the front desk. There was an ice machine available on the floor, but the ice bucket lid didn't fit. Only a couple of paper cups in the room--no glassware.
